Brief summary

The aim of this study is to determine whether Ultrasound Doppler imaging can identify malignant tumors at a very early stage.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frameDescription
Early characterization of malignant tumorsOne yearComparison of Ultrasound Doppler findings at different speeds between women without tumors, with benign tumors and with malignant tumors of reproductive system
